Bundle Gem

With all the information necessary to start, I first set up the basic directories that I could edit to create my application. In the terminal, I ran bundle gem galaxy_far_away_cli. The bundle gem is a life saver to newbies like myself for creating all the files I needed, including a readme file and a Code of Conduct file! Now that the basic directories were set up I created a markdown notes file so that I could map out what I needed to create to make this app functional.

I know I needed three classes for this application to work. An API class that gets and creates objects, a film class that knows, stores, and creates films, a species class that does the same but with species and finally a CLI class that is going to be doing the heavy lifting of my app.

APIService Class

I used HTTParty gem to do the bulk of the work of getting the API, plus it saved me a few lines of code with an added bonus being that it has the word party in it! Since the endpoint of the API required different params for returning the information I wanted, I had to concatenate to the end of the BASE_URI. Initially I used a fancy .concat but when I would try to run my code it would break! Oh the frustration that caused! Turned out using .concat would create a funny error where it would add up both params together which was just wonky. The old tried and true way of just using a simple + was the right way to go.

Film Class
   def initialize(attr_hash)
        attr_hash.each do |k, v|
            self.send("#{k}=", v) if self.respond_to?("#{k}=")
        end
        save
    end

This little guy right here is a really higher level way of saying for each key and value of the hash returned from the API, it’s going to return the individual objects designated by the attr_accessor but only if it can find a designated key for it! Oh and the save method being called there is just a way to save the objects being created by the class into an empty array called @@all.
